std.os.linux.tls: Handle riscv32 in setThreadPointer().

This commit is contained in:
Alex Rønne Petersen
2024-06-22 15:02:09 +02:00
parent aeb3abc7e6
commit 6eb9cb6f28

View File

@@ -170,7 +170,7 @@ pub fn setThreadPointer(addr: usize) void {
const rc = @call(.always_inline, linux.syscall1, .{ .set_tls, addr });
assert(rc == 0);
},
.riscv64 => {
.riscv32, .riscv64 => {
asm volatile (
\\ mv tp, %[addr]
: